Nestled in the vibrant heart of Cyberjaya, Tamarind Square offers a prime location for ambitious business owners . With its sleek, modern designs , Tamarind Square features a dynamic atmosphere that fosters collaboration and growth. The diverse selection of retail spaces cater to a wide range of ventures. From service providers, Tamarind Square o… Read More